Unless your home is located in a rural area, don't forget about those who are around you before installing any fence. This of course means your neighbors, and you may have to pay attention to your local laws about zoning, but you would think that you could put up a fence on your garden if you want. There actually are laws that apply to putting up fences, but it just may be a matter of what crazy state you're living in. In addition, you really don't want to anger your neighbors with a fence that causes any kind of issues.

If you have a pet such as a dog or anything else, this is an important factor to consider with a new fence, and you will have to determine if you want the fence to contain your pet so it can run freely in your garden. If this is the case, you can have a boundary fence or a rail fence, but you'll need to install something at the base such as chicken wire to keep the pet in the garden. The important thing here is that the dog won't get out or jump the fence plus you want it to be safe for your pet.
